Summary

Harlow and Malcolm Sullivan, 18 and 21, are living together in their own home after their parents kicked them out of their previous residence. Sullivans, William and Cassandra.  Malcolm works two part-time jobs after school to help fend for both himself and his sister. Their  life was going well until Harlow started seeing some type of...creature. I'd say it's a gruesome one.

Chapter 1


It was only yesterday since I saw him . . . Well, it’s more like IT. What I saw was no man. It had no face. No feet. No hands. Just a ripped suit with its long arms and legs, which have an unnaturally long claw. I saw him, staring at me, deep into my soul. And through the window. I told my brother about it . . . He says it’s because of my all-nighters, and horror movies I watch, that I’m seeing things. I believe him. I think.

Last night I couldn’t sleep so I went to get some water then . . . I saw it. She was staring at me, from outside the kitchen window. It felt like there was nothing around us, but darkness.

I wake up the next day to the brutal ringing of my alarm clock. I groan as I move to stop it. I’m half asleep. The loud obnoxious ringing stopped, but I didn’t touch it . . . Lifting my head so very slowly, I try to scream, but my mouth just falls open, with no sound coming out. It’s the man I saw last night. I stare at his arm, which leads to my chest. His arm is going right through me.

I sat up fast. Gasping for air as if it’s trying to run far, far away from me.

“It was a dream..” I mumble to myself. My chest. Oh, my chest. It’s sore . . . Suddenly, there’s a knock at my door. “Harlow,” he opens the door. “You’re gonna be late for morning classes! Hurry up.” I rub my eyes and nod. He stares at me, and I stare back. “You okay?” He asks. “Yes, why are you asking?” He’s staring at me like I’m crazy, now. “You screamed earlier,” he says, now examining the room.

“What do you mean?” My heart is pounding a little too quickly.

“Yeah, um..- I’ll just tell them you’re sick.”

“No, no, I’m coming. Just let me get dressed.” I stumble to my feet. He gives me a quick nod, before leaving my room. I inhale sharply, then I go to get ready.

“Malcolm?” I call out his name while heading downstairs. “You finally ready?” He tilts his head at me. I roll my eyes and fight the urge to laugh but smile instead. “Let’s go, big brother of mine.” We make our way to his car and in the passenger seat window, I see the thing in the reflection behind me. This time I scream, and turn around brutally, only to see nothing there.

“Um..” I turn back around to see Malcolm staring at me weirdly. “Sorry.” I choke out. He laughs calmly, then we both get in the car. Malcolm is always working, even though we both have school. He’s always trying to get as much money as he can for both of us. Mother and father never really liked us that much. They kicked us out of their house 2 years ago.

They still visit occasionally, for money, mostly to laugh in our faces and tell us how much they regret having us. Malcolm’s always defending me, no matter the situation. I’m glad I have him, to be entirely honest. Maybe- “We’re here.” The sound of his voice kicks me out of my thoughts. “What? Already?”

He looks at me with a mocking smile. I sigh, but I don’t know if it’s a sigh of relief or something else. “Of course, you took the shortcut.” His smile grows wider, as he says “Maybe.”

I get out of the car and grab my bag. Malcolm does the same.

“What class do you have this morning?”

“I’m pretty sure it’s English. We’re starting Myths and Legends today.”

“They’re not myths or legends,” he says, making weird movements with his hands. “They’re real. Monsters who creep up on you at night, and stare at you.” I instantly think about that thing I saw, last night and this morning.

A shiver shoots up my spine. “Y’know what? Let’s not… talk about that.” I say, walking toward the entrance. There are about 4 minutes left until class but there are certain students outside. So I’m a bit relieved. “Aw, are you scared?” He grins at me and I have to fight the urge to smile.

“Uh-huh. I’m heading to class, bye!” I wave goodbye and leave for Myths and Legends class. I’ve been trying not to think about my sore chest, the arm it had in my body. My silent scream. The feeling of agony for those ten seconds felt like an eternity. I shiver just thinking about it.

I get to my classroom and everyone’s already in their seat. And all their eyes turn to face me. I can feel my face flushing with embarrassment. I rush to my seat and- “Harlow! Very nice of you to join us, six minutes into the lesson.” I freeze in place as I hear the harsh and unfriendly voice of my professor. Now, I’m certain I’m blushing. “I, uh-” I try to say something. Anything. But I’m too embarrassed to form words right now.

He waves a hand at me, “Just get to your seat so I can continue, please.” I give him a quick nod and rush to my seat. I hear a few giggles, and whispers in the room, and I sink into my seat, trying to ignore them.

Professor Adler continues the lesson. Y’know, Professor Adler is kind of intimidating, but he’s nice. I mean, he gets annoyed when you’re late, Which is my bad. He’s calm with us and understanding. I sometimes ask myself why my parents aren’t like that . . .

I wonder if I should tell him about that man I saw. Would he believe me? Probably not, however, he might let me talk to him about it.

“Harlow?” I startle at the sound of his voice. “Y-Yes?” I look up at him. He’s standing, not even ten feet away from me, and he frowns. “I need you to pay attention, alright,” his voice is soft. I nod once, twice. Adler turns away again and he’s saying something about vampires. Goodness, I’m so tired, I keep on zoning out. But I’ll make it through the lesson.

“Miss Sullivan.” As everyone is leaving, I stop right in front of the door and turn around slowly. “Yes?” He looks at me, studies my face even. “Come sit,” he says, pointing at a seat in front of him. “There’s something on your mind, so tell me about it.” I’m stunned.

“How did you?-”

“It’s written all over your face.” He grins.

“Okay.. Well,” I sit in the chair. “Last night, I saw this… thing. I mean, a man, but it wasn’t really a man. Like, he was a greyish tan colour. He didn’t have a face.. Or hands, or feet… But a ripped thin black suit, with arms and legs that end… In sort of- like spikes.” I make gestures with my hands as if they mean something, and I look up at Professor Adler who isn’t smiling anymore, his eyes widened, slightly flashing with worry. “Continue…” He says slowly. “I was getting a cup of water last night, and that’s when I first saw him, or it. And this morning…” I look to the floor now, unintentionally putting a hand on my chest. “Its arm.. Was right through me. Here.” I point a finger at my chest now, tapping it. “And I woke up again, sore in that spot.” I look back up and see the horror in his eyes, and it quickly disappears.

Adler clears his throat. “Right, yes,” he gets up from his desk. “I… will see you tomorrow, Harlow.” He attempts a smile, which comes out all wrong. It’s not reassuring. He walks me to the door, slightly pushing my back. “But-” I try to say something but he just pats my shoulder and closes the door. Well, that was nice. Definitely not the reaction I was expecting from him. Maybe I creeped him out a little? But he’s a Myths and Legends teacher. Okay, there’s probably something wrong then… I have to find Malcolm before my next class.

I start searching the halls. I check outside, and he’s not there. Shoot. Maybe the bathroom? I head there, speed walking like I’m in a supermarket. I open the door slowly. I can’t go inside, since it’s the boys’ bathroom.

“Malcolm-” A sudden thud and grunt cause my eyes to widen.

“You Sullivans are such freaks.” Someone says, chuckling after. I feel my body tense up, and I clench my fist, unintentionally. “Please, just leave me be.” I hear my brother say. I have to do something, but my feet are stuck in place for some reason. I can’t move.
